Why Rural Roads Need a Different Approach

Rural roads often carry lower traffic volumes, but that doesn’t make them less important. In fact, these roads serve critical roles in agriculture, logistics, emergency access, and community connection. However, rural settings present challenges:

  • Unsealed surfaces degrade quickly in harsh weather
  • Dust control is essential near residential or agricultural areas
  • Heavy-duty paving options may be too expensive or unnecessary

This is where spray and seal bitumen comes into its own.

What Makes Spray & Seal Bitumen Lightweight?

Spray and seal differs from deep-layer asphalt in both composition and method. It involves spraying a thin layer of hot bitumen followed by a layer of aggregate. The process may be repeated for added durability.

The benefits of this lightweight structure include:

  • Reduced load on underlying ground
  • Lower material volumes compared to thick asphalt
  • Less site preparation required
  • Faster curing and traffic-readiness

This makes it ideal for roads where base support may be limited or where full-depth paving would be excessive.

Faster Application in Regional Environments

For many rural areas, time and access are significant factors. The spray and seal process allows for rapid deployment with minimal equipment, making it easier to complete jobs with fewer disruptions. Benefits include:

  • Quicker turnaround from start to finish
  • Reduced labour time on-site
  • Ability to seal long distances in a single day
  • Less traffic diversion and downtime for local users

These time savings are a major win for councils, farmers, and property owners who rely on smooth, accessible roads.

Dust Control and Cleaner Travel

Unsealed rural roads are notorious for generating dust, which is not only a nuisance but also a health risk and a hazard for visibility. Spray and seal eliminates this issue by binding dust and providing a stable, sealed surface. This means:

  • Cleaner vehicles and nearby properties
  • Safer driving conditions in dry or windy weather
  • Better air quality for residents and livestock

For Southport landowners and regional operators, it’s a long-term improvement with immediate returns.

Cost-Effective Over the Long Term

While spray and seal is already more affordable up front than full asphalt, its real value lies in the longevity it delivers when installed correctly. A well-executed spray and seal surface will:

  • Withstand regular rural traffic loads
  • Resist erosion and water damage
  • Offer easy and affordable resealing after several years

This makes it a sustainable choice for long-term infrastructure planning in rural Southport and the surrounding areas.
